BOBST training empowers Westrock Dublin die-cutting operators & boosts site performance

Packaging specialist, WestRock, has revealed the significant productivity and efficiency gains achieved after investing in a BOBST training programme.

Operators within the die-cutting department at WestRock’s Dublin site, undertook training over a period of 12 months as WestRock sought to upskill its workforce and ensure performance targets were accomplished.
Following the training process, make-readies have reduced by an average of 16 minutes and downtime by 15%. At the same time, sheets per man hour (SPMH) have increased by more than 30%.
The site in Dublin specialises in manufacturing complex packaging for the pharmaceutical and chemicals sectors, requiring exacting precision and accuracy. With four BOBST die-cutters on site, Cut & Crease Manager, Chris Richardson, was keen to ensure operators were achieving optimum performance from the machines.
“Twelve months ago, while we knew we had a great team, we realised that we didn’t have a huge amount of experience working across all shifts and there was a need for upskilling,” said Chris. “The work we were taking on was becoming more complex. It had become clear that we needed to improve department performance and create a knowledge base to ensure we could continue to deliver the high standards our customers expected.
“The make-ready improvement has had the biggest impact for customers and since the training began we have seen a significant reduction, around 50%, in customer complaints,” Chris added. “The training from BOBST has re-energised us and empowered operators to make better decisions and resolve problems themselves. Ultimately, the team understands the capabilities of the machines better.
“In addition, more senior members of staff have been freed up to focus on other roles and responsibilities. For example, the training has provided us with the right techniques for zonal patching - the most complex of tooling – and is now carried out by trainees without a problem.”
